TEAC Esoteric is celebrating its 20th year of offering impeccably high quality A/V components by releasing a new top of the line SACD player. The X-05 was designed without compromise to be a CD player capable of reproducing a signal with the least amount of distortion possible. In order to accomplish this, TEAC has redesigned the CD player from the ground up with a high precision turntable disc drive system, a highly adjustable spindle mechanism and a new pickup system that is always on axis to the disc.



In addition, TEAC has incorporated a quieter loading mechanism, a 24-bit 192kHz DAC and a highly isolated dual-mono amp configuration. A CD player with a level of precision this high is not cheap, the X-05 will retail for about $5,000 when it is released in January.
